Hello everyone

And I found that there was a paradox in this video:
The motor rotates at 1400RPM. It is explained that this motor is an asynchronous motor.
The principle of asynchronous motor is: its rotor mechanical rotation frequency is always lower than the stator armature magnetic field rotation frequency.
That is, asynchronous motors have a 'slip rate'.
So, in this video system, the frequency of the current emitted by the four sets of magnets and coils is the mechanical frequency of the asynchronous motor rotor.
That is, the electrical frequency corresponding to 1400RPM.
This electrical frequency is supplied to the asynchronous motor, and the rotor speed of the motor will be lower than 1400 RPM.
As a result, the rotor speed will be lower than 1400RPM.
Then, the four sets of magnets and coils emit current at a lower frequency than the electrical frequency corresponding to 1400 RPM.
In this way, the asynchronous motor must gradually stop rotating.

In this video, the electricity generated by the four sets of magnets and coils does not pass through the inverter。
So it's weird.

In addition, if the motor in the video is synchronous, the frequency of this system cannot be stabilized and will vary widely.
